Um, you guys do realize that poly bushings on the 2-bolt arms is just increasing the effective spring rate for the front end, right?

This is why the 4-bolt arms are considered better, because the bushings themselves don't contribute to the effective spring rate of the corner. If you want a true upgrade to the stock arm that will actually improve function, look at something more like the ones bensenvill posted above.
